WebThe earthworm’s skin has glands that give off . mucus. This mucus helps . the earthworm breathe because it keeps the body moist. The earthworm breathes through its thin skin. Oxygen dissolves in . the moisture on the . earthworm’s body, and then passes into the body. When long muscles tighten—or contract— the segment is squeezed so it ...
